当前汽车销售行业正经历数字化转型的关键时期,传统线下购车模式存在诸多痛点。消费者在选购车辆时,往往需要耗费大量时间精力往返于不同经销商之间,信息获取渠道有限且不对称,车辆价格、车况历史、售后服务等关键信息透明度低。对于汽车经销商而言,获客成本高企,销售渠道单一,难以精准触达潜在客户,且线下运营成本(如场地租金、人力成本)持续攀升。这种低效、高成本的模式严重制约了汽车流通市场的健康发展。
在此背景下,构建一个集车辆展示、信息查询、在线沟通、交易撮合于一体的数字化平台显得尤为迫切。该平台旨在打破地域限制,消除信息壁垒,为买卖双方搭建一个高效、透明、可信赖的交易环境。其社会价值在于提升汽车消费体验,促进市场信息的自由流动;经济价值则体现在通过优化资源配置,降低交易成本,显著提升车辆流通效率,为经销商开辟新的增长渠道,为消费者创造实实在在的便利与实惠。
可行性分析
技术可行性
本项目采用成熟的SSM(Spring + Spring MVC + MyBatis)框架组合进行后端开发,这是一套在Java企业级应用开发中经过长期实践验证的经典技术栈。Spring框架负责业务对象的管理和事务控制,其依赖注入和面向切面编程特性能够确保系统具有良好的可维护性和扩展性。Spring MVC为Web层提供了清晰的MVC模型,便于实现请求路由、参数绑定和视图渲染。MyBatis作为持久层框架,通过灵活的SQL映射,能够高效地处理车辆信息、订单数据等复杂查询与操作。前端采用标准的HTML、CSS和JavaScript技术,结合JSP进行动态页面渲染,技术门槛低,社区资源丰富,开发风险可控。数据库选用MySQL,其稳定性和性能足以支撑平台初期的数据存储与访问需求。总体而言,所选技术栈生态完善,学习资料充足,在技术层面具备高度可行性。
经济可行性
项目开发成本主要集中在人力成本上。由于采用开源技术栈,无需支付昂贵的软件许可费用。硬件方面,初期可采用云服务器,按需配置,有效控制基础设施投入。运营成本主要包括服务器维护、带宽费用及日常运维人力成本。 预期收益则体现在多个维度:对于平台运营方,可通过向入驻经销商收取技术服务费、广告推广费等模式实现盈利;对于汽车经销商,平台能帮助其降低获客成本,扩大销售半径,提升成交率,间接带来可观的经济效益;对于消费者,则节省了购车的时间成本与信息搜寻成本。从投资回报角度看,项目初期投入相对有限,而潜在的长期收益和市场份额价值显著,具备良好的经济可行性。
操作可行性
平台设计将用户体验置于核心位置。前端界面计划设计简洁直观,导航清晰,符合大众用户的浏览习惯。车辆搜索支持多条件筛选(如品牌、价格区间、里程等),方便用户快速定位目标车辆。购物车、订单管理、个人中心等功能模块逻辑 straightforward,用户无需复杂学习即可上手操作。对于管理员和经销商后台,功能菜单布局合理,数据可视化程度高(如销量统计图表),便于进行日常管理和业务决策。考虑到目标用户群体普遍具备基本的互联网使用技能,平台的操作流程设计符合用户心智模型,因此在操作层面具备充分的可行性。
功能需求分析
系统主要涉及三类用户角色:系统管理员、汽车经销商(卖家)、个人消费者(买家)。
1. 系统管理员 管理员负责平台的全局管理与运维,确保系统稳定、合规运行。
- 用户与权限管理:审核经销商入驻申请,管理所有注册用户(买家与卖家)的基本信息,分配和调整后台操作权限。
- 内容管理:负责维护平台的核心内容,包括发布行业动态、平台公告(对应
news表),管理首页轮播图,处理用户留言反馈(对应message表)。 - 商品与分类管理:审核经销商上架的车辆信息,确保信息真实合规。维护车辆分类体系(如品牌、车型等分类,对应
product表中的fid,sid等字段)。 - 订单与售后监管:监控所有交易订单(对应
ordermsg表)的流程,处理异常订单,监督售后申请的处理情况,维护交易公平。 - 数据统计与分析:查看平台关键指标,如销售总额(对应
ordermsg表中的total字段)、成交量、用户活跃度等,为运营决策提供数据支持。
2. 汽车经销商(卖家) 经销商通过平台销售车辆,是平台内容的主要提供方。
- 店铺管理:维护店铺基本信息,如联系方式、简介等。
- 车辆管理:这是核心模块。经销商可以添加、编辑、上下架(对应
product表中的issj字段)待售车辆。需填写详细的车辆信息(品牌、型号、价格、里程、图片等,对应product表各字段),并可设置推荐车辆(对应istj字段)。 - 库存管理:实时查看车辆库存状态,跟踪每一辆车的在售、已售情况。
- 订单处理:接收并处理买家下达的订单,更新订单状态(如确认收款、安排发货,对应
ordermsg表中的fkstatus,shstatus字段)。 - 销售统计:查看本店铺的销售数据,分析经营状况。
- 客户沟通:通过平台内消息系统与潜在买家进行沟通,解答疑问。
3. 个人消费者(买家) 买家是平台的最终服务对象,其功能需求围绕购车全流程设计。
- 用户中心:注册/登录,管理个人资料、密码。
- 车辆浏览与搜索:通过首页、分类导航或关键词搜索发现车辆。支持按价格、品牌、车龄、里程等多种条件组合筛选,精准定位需求。
- 车辆详情查看:查看车辆高清图片、详细参数、车况描述、价格信息(对应
product表)及卖家信息。 - 收藏与对比:将心仪车辆加入收藏夹(对应
favorites逻辑),方便后续比较和决策。 - 购物车与订单:将选中的车辆加入购物车,一次性结算。生成订单时,可选择或管理收货地址(对应
address表),选择支付方式(对应ordermsg表中的zffs字段)。支持查看订单历史、跟踪订单状态。 - 在线支付:集成第三方支付接口,完成安全、便捷的在线支付。
- 互动功能:向卖家留言咨询,对已购车辆进行评价。
- 优惠券使用:在下单时使用平台或商家发放的优惠券(对应
ticket表),抵扣部分金额。
非功能性需求
- 性能需求:系统页面平均响应时间应小于3秒。在关键操作如车辆搜索、订单提交等场景下,响应时间需小于2秒。系统应能支持至少1000用户在线并发访问。
- 安全性需求:用户密码需进行不可逆加密存储。严格实施基于角色的访问控制(RBAC),确保不同角色只能访问其授权范围内的功能和数据。对用户提交的数据进行有效性校验和防SQL注入、XSS攻击过滤。交易过程中的敏感信息(如支付信息)需进行加密传输。
- 可靠性需求:系统年可用性应达到99.9%以上。具备数据定期备份与恢复机制,防止数据丢失。关键业务操作需有事务保证,确保数据一致性。
- 易用性需求:界面设计简洁美观,操作流程符合直觉,提供清晰的操作指引和反馈。支持主流浏览器访问。
- 可扩展性需求:系统架构应具备良好的可扩展性,便于未来增加新功能模块(如金融服务、保险服务)或应对用户量、数据量的增长。
业务流程与用例分析
核心业务流程一:买家购车流程
- 搜索浏览:买家通过关键词搜索或分类导航进入车辆列表页,利用筛选条件缩小范围。
- 查看详情:点击感兴趣的车辆,进入详情页,仔细查看车辆图片、参数、价格和卖家信息。
- 加入购物车/收藏:可将车辆加入购物车准备购买,或加入收藏夹以便比较。
- 下单结算:在购物车中确认购买车辆,选择收货地址(或新增地址),选择支付方式。系统计算总金额(可能扣除优惠券)。
- 支付:跳转至支付页面完成支付操作。支付成功后,订单状态更新为“待发货”。
- 订单跟踪:买家可在“我的订单”中查看订单状态,如“已发货”、“已完成”。
- 确认收货与评价:收到车辆后,确认收货,并可对此次购车体验进行评价。
核心业务流程二:卖家车辆上架与订单管理流程
- 车辆上架:卖家登录后台,进入车辆管理模块,填写新车信息(车辆编号、名称、图片、价格、描述、分类等),提交后等待管理员审核(若需)。
- 信息维护:可对已上架车辆的信息进行编辑、下架或重新上架操作。
- 订单通知:当有买家下单购买其车辆时,系统会生成新订单通知卖家。
- 订单处理:卖家查看订单详情(买家信息、收货地址、支付方式),确认收款无误后,更新订单状态为“已发货”,并填写发货信息。
- 售后处理:如遇买家退货或售后申请,卖家需根据平台规则进行沟通和处理。
结论
综合以上分析,基于SSM框架的在线车辆销售交易平台项目,不仅切中了当前汽车销售市场的核心痛点,具备明确的市场需求和显著的社会经济价值,而且在技术、经济、操作三个维度均展现出高度的可行性。项目功能规划全面,覆盖了从车辆展示、搜索、交易到售后管理的完整业务闭环,角色权限划分清晰。对非功能性需求的考量也为系统的稳定性、安全性和用户体验提供了保障。该项目的成功实施,将有力推动汽车销售行业的数字化转型,为经销商和消费者创造双赢的价值,是一个值得投入开发和推广的优秀项目。